Hood: Outlaws & Legends Gets Gameplay Breakdown


The latest trailer for Focus Home Interactive and Sumo Digital's Hood: Outlaws & Legends breaks down the team-based action and tactics of this multiplayer heist game.

Hood: Outlaws & Legends pits players against a rival group of four others. The ultimate goal is to steal treasure, which has teams infiltrating towering strongholds, outsmarting foes in PvPvE battles, and claiming glory. One can fight in the shadows, or go for a more up-close-and-personal style of close quarters combat.

Featuring medieval environments patrolled by deadly AI guards, Hood: Outlaws & Legends strikes a balance between mysticism, man-made power, and corruption The title will also feature post-launch support with new characters, maps, game modes, and events.

Those that pre-order the title can get the "Forest Lords" cosmetic pack and exclusive early access to the game on May 7, three days before its May 10 launch. The game will come out for the P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Xbox One, Xbox Series S/X, and PC.

Double XP in Red Dead Online This Week


Net yourself Double XP on all Free Roam Missions and Free Roam Events this week in Rockstar Games' Red Dead Online.

In addition to the aforementioned bonuses, Posses can get themselves 40% bonus RDO$/XP Payouts in Free Roam Missions.

There are a number of perks for those who level up from now through April 19. Scope out the full list below:

  • Gain one Rank and get the Bluewater Marsh Treasure Map
  • Gain three Ranks and get the North Ridgewood Treasure Map and a free Ability Card
  • Gain six Ranks and get the lake Isabella Treasure Map, two free Ability Cards, and RDO$150

For those looking to get around (and look good while doing it), Fast Travel is free this week and Barbers are offering all of their services at no cost.

The Wheeler, Rawson & Co. Catalogue will see the following items return for a limited time:

  • Carbow Double Bandolier
  • Fernwater Coat
  • Torranca Coat (available in select colors)
  • Folwell Hat
  • Griffith Chaps (available in select colors)
  • Porter Jacket

Discount-wise, Gunsmiths are offering up 30% off all Shotguns, Repeaters and Gun Belts. Meanwhile, Tailors are offering 30% off the retail cost of all Pants, Skirts and Boots. Finally, Stables offer 40% off all Stable Slots, Horse Tonics, Horse Food, plus War and Work Horse breeds.

Finally, Red Dead Online players that have connected their Rockstar Games Social Club account to their Prime Gaming will receive Rewards for a free Bounty Hunter License and an Award for the Trimmed Amethyst Bounty Wagon Livery. Those who connect to Prime Gaming before May 10 will receive Offers and Rewards for a free Varmint Rifle, 50 free Trader Goods, and 30% off the Hunting Wagon.

Disco Elysium: The Final Cut Review

A couple of years after Disco Elysium hit the scene, ZA/UM has released the Final Cut on the PlayStation 5. Find out if the game is worth checking out two years later with our review.

Disco Elysium: The Final Cut Review

Disco Elysium begins with you waking up in a haze, one where you can't remember who you are or what you are doing. As it turns out, you drank so much that you are now suffering from some sort of amnesia. You groggily collect your clothes and stumble downstairs to try and find out what is going on, but quickly learn you are a detective sent to investigate a murder. After a man was found hanging from a tree behind the hotel you are staying at, you now need to find out what happened. Thankfully, a different precinct sent the detective Kim Kitsuragi to help you out, with him filling you in on the details. While you haven't worked together before, you have been assigned as partners for this case.

Figuring out who you are and what you were doing is only the beginning of your nightmare. It turns out that in your drunken stupor, you lost your badge and sold your gun. The body out back has been hanging for a week, and now smells so bad you can't approach it without getting sick. There is a massive strike going on outside of the union, so getting to the boss to ask him questions about the murder is difficult. To top it all off, you owe the hotel $130 and you are broke. Cleaning up this mess will take roughly 20-25 hours.

Disco Elysium The Final Cut Honest Review

Disco Elysium is an RPG, but not your typical RPG. You don't do much combat, and even the combat isn't controlled by you. That is because a lot of skills are based on dice rolls. Some are easy to pass, while others are impossible. This is where your skills come into play – and there are a ton of them. There are 24 different skills to pick from, and each of them plays a separate role. These skills act as your inner voice and point out things you may have missed. However, skills can clash with one another, leaving you to sort out which one to believe. Is the suspect lying, or is he just scared? Empathy says one thing, while Drama says another.

The skill system plays into the replayability of the game as well. A different build and play style won't change the game's outcome, but it will change each conversation. You also get new clothes to wear, which will improve specific skills. You can turn your weaker skills into strong ones by wearing the right outfit. Booze, drugs, and cigarettes will give you temporary boosts at the expense of HP or Morale. The boost can be worth it – assuming Kim isn't watching you do speed and you don't kill yourself by doing it. I had to buy a raincoat, drink some wine, and increase my endurance to get the body down without puking my guts out. I'm sure there are other ways to do it, but that one worked for me.

Disco Elysium The Final Cut Honest Game Review

Another strength of the game is how it lets you be the kind of detective you want to be. With no memory of who you are, you can say all sorts of things about your past. You can play it straight, ask questions, get info, and find the perp. You can be the cop of the apocalypse, foretelling of the coming doom, and thoroughly confusing your partner. Superstar cop is a winner. Disco may be dead in our world, but in Disco Elysium, you are a star. Give people that "Look" and the finger guns to let them know you are a cool cop who isn't above taking bribes. You get to play the way you want to play.

The other main thing this title tasks you with is exploring. There is a lot to see, even though the game world isn't that large. Tiny dots flood the world, providing context, new info, and other little tidbits that help you get a feel for the area. By exploring these dots, you will unlock thoughts. Your thoughts range from ridiculous to just wondering how old you are. Thoughts require time to sort out completely and will give you an effect when the thought is completed. When they are finished, they will usually provide you with a new buff. You might get a bonus to one of your skills or get bonus experience for certain conversation choices. You can also become a communist if you want, though the bonus to that one isn't great.

Disco Elysium The Final Cut Game Review

I played this on PC when it released, but never got through it. The Final Cut voices most of the game, which proves to be a massive boon that makes it easier to navigate. That being said, there were some problems. I did have a couple of crashes, which hurts because the game doesn't autosave often. There were some UI glitches where text boxes would stay on screen. I couldn't complete certain quests, and conversations would stop having options to talk. The quest to get my gun back took me five times of hard closing the game and re-opening it to actually work. I still enjoyed my time with it, but there were some definite issues.

While Disco Elysium: The Final Cut won't appeal to everyone, those that do enjoy it will sing its praises for a long time to come. Just be prepared for a few bugs if you play on console.

Catopia: Rush Soft Launch Coming April 21


The team at Supercolony announced that their team-based, dungeon-crawling cat adventure Catopia: Rush will have a soft launch on April 21, 2021.

Featuring more than 50 collectible cat heroes, Catopia: Rush puts players in the shoes of the prince of Catopia, who must rescue the villagers from the Dark Lord and the brainwashed Prince Zektor. In order to restore peace to the kingdom, players can unlock different cat heroes, level up, and increase their Cat Power.

Each team is made up of one Hero Cat and three Ally Cats that feature the Tank, Support, Mage, and Warrior archetypes. Much like a bullet-hell shmup, the Hero Cats of the group are the only ones that can take damage. A talent and equipment system will also be included, along with Expedition stages and specialized daily challenges.

Age of Empires IV Gameplay Trailer Released


One of the best-selling RTS series makes its return with Xbox Game Studios, Relic Entertainment, and World's Edge's Age of Empires IV – see it in action with the latest gameplay trailer for the game.

New to the game is the playable Delhi Sultanate civilization. In addition, the iconic War Elephant unit will make its return. In true series' fashion, spearmen, archers, and more combat-oriented construction will develop as civilizations start to age-up and skirmishes escalate to war.

Revealed during the global fan preview for the series, the trailer below takes a look at the new Norman campaign. This campaign tells the story of Duke William of Normandy as he wrestles control of England from King Harold.

Presentation-wise, the game draws inspiration from gilded manuscripts of the time, with the "golden soldiers" projecting historical events over present-day real-world locations.

S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ID Review

A risk-reward title that encourages wild driving, kunstwerk's S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ID (yes, we checked that we spelled that correctly) has players burning rubber to get ahead. Does this time-honored tradition translate well to this title, or have players seen this play out one too many times before?

S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ID Review

Each of S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ID's 30 levels keeps things simple and to the point. Your hot set of wheels needs some fuel, and there just so happens to be fuel cans dotting the landscape. With your foot on the gas, players can pick up the pace and enter a skid the moment they turn left or right. Players will be able to do so with either the WASD keys or arrow keys, but there's no need to worry about anything else but direction. Collect each can, watch the screen flash with joy on each one, and move on to the next stage.

However, there lies an always-imminent danger with the buzzsaws that also inhabit each world. Whether they be right in front of you or slowly creeping in from the sides, players will have to contend with these threats as they maneuver around. All poor unfortunate souls that touch one meet an untimely demise, so it pays to be perfect.

This combo is simple at its core, and S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ID's minimalistic presentation really drives this fact home. However, what is here works as it should. Players won't be playing around with gears or even hitting the breaks; rather, what is here is pure and works as it should. While it takes some getting used to, those who can wrap their head around its system will enjoy hitting the perfect line to get ahead. It can be tricky at certain moments, but even the most challenging level of the lot can be vanquished without too much frustration.

It's just a shame that this simplicity also applies to this game's depth. Each level has just a handful of gas canisters, and collecting them all in the perfect run can easily be done in less than a minute, if not less than 30 seconds.

While it's nice that this game is a tight package, it also prevents players from coming back to this title again down the road. Completing its suite of levels takes around 40 minutes if you're really pacing yourself, which is good for the price tag but somewhat limited in its lasting appeal. No achievements, timer, or anything other than a menu select with all levels unlocked are available. While it's nice that the color scheme for each level changes on each attempt, there's little variety between each run and levels quickly start to bleed together.

SKIIIIIIIIIIIIIIID's minimalistic nature is both its greatest strength and its biggest weakness. Boiling the racing genre down to its most basic elements means that there's absolutely no fluff, but this ultimately kills any replayability it may have had.

NEO: The World Ends with You Launching July 27


Get ready to enter the Reaper's Game when Square Enix's NEO: The World Ends with You launches on July 27, 2021.

Featuring an anime-style version of Shibuya, this title puts players in the shoes of Rindo, leader of the Wicked Twisters. Finding himself in a battle to win the "Reapers' Game, he must team up with characters like Fret and Nagi, Koki Kariya, and Sho Minamimototo to survive.

Gameplay has players collecting badges to gain psych abilities to take on foes in action battles. Tying everything together is both an amped-up soundtrack by Takeharu Ishimoto (who composed the original game) and an intriguing, stylish story. It is the first game in the series to feature 3D graphics.

Deathloop Delayed to September 14


The official Deathloop Twitter account released a statement today stating that the title has been delayed to September 14, 2021.

Arkane Lyon Game Director Dinga Bakaba and Art Director Sebastien Mitton both stated that the studio has a strong vision for the game, one they do not want to compromise. To ensure the health and safety of everyone in the studio, the team has moved the date. They stated that this delay will allow the team to create a truly stylish, fun, and mind-bending experience.

You can view both the written and video statements from Arkane Lyon below:

A next-gen first person shooter, Deathloop puts players in the shoes of the Colt. This assassin finds himself stuck in a time loop on the island of Blackreef, where he must take out eight different targets before the aforementioned time loop undoes his work. Much like Arkane's previous title Dishonored, players can utilize a blend of stealth, parkour, and attack skills to take down their targets. A multiplayer component will also be included.

The game will come out for the PlayStation 5 and PC via Steam.

No More Heroes 3 Gets Series Digest Movie


Join series mainstay Sylvia Christel as she walks players through the world of Grasshopper Manufacture and Marvelous' No More Heroes with the following series digest video.

Longtime fans and newcomers alike will be able to tune into The Garden of Sylvia to get a recap of the series so far.

The original No More Heroes kicks things off with the courier Travis Touchdown winning a beam katana in an online auction. With a knack for battle, he enters the United Assassin's Association in a bid to become the number one ranked assassin.

Following the events of the original entry, No More Heroes 2: Desperate Struggle has Travis dropping down to the 51st rank. Not one to take things sitting down, he teams up with Shinobu to get back to the number one ranking.

Finally, the events of Travis Strikes Again: No More Heroes is a spinoff that has Travis going inside the video game world. With a Metascore of 67, Sylvia mentioned that this is the type of title that will be fawned over in 10 years.

Note that players can just as easily dive into No More Heroes 3 with no previous knowledge of the series.

Wonder Boy: Asha in Monster World Gets New Trailer


A game with roots dating back to the 90s, see the world of ININ Games' Wonder Boy: Asha in Monster World in action with the latest trailer for the game.

Asha and Pepelogoo's adventure has been designed to stay true to the series' roots with help from the original team. Director Ryuichi Nishizawa, Sound Designer Shinichi Sakamoto, Character Designer Maki Ozora, and Creative Management lead Takanori Kurihara have all lent a hand with this remaster.

Originally released for the SEGA Mega Drive in 1994, Wonder Boy: Asha in Monster World is an amalgamation of action-adventure, platforming and RPG elements. After the titular Asha hears spirits whispering in the wind for help, she embarks on a journey to find and help them. Her journey soon finds her becoming the master of a genie and adopting the small Pepelogoo monster.

This updated release will include 3D graphics, gameplay enhancements, and a number of new modes.

The game will come out in Q2 2021 for the PlayStation 4 and Nintendo Switch. The physical version of the game will include the original release of Monster World IV.
